Obama Interrupted at University of Maryland by 'Pro life Moderate' Yelling: 'Liar!'
Date:9/17/2009

COLLEGE PARK, Md., Sept. 17 /PRNewswire-USNewswire/ -- The following was released today by Joe Landry, Operation Rescue: Insurrecta Nex:

Obama's speech was interrupted today by Andrew Beacham, 26, member of Operation Rescue: Insurrecta Nex, saying, "You are a liar! Your health care kills children! Abortion is murder! And you are a murderer! Insurrecta Nex!"

Andrew Beacham, of Arlington, VA, has been arrested "prophesying" to Mr. Obama at Notre Dame's commencement; to the senate judiciary committee's interview of Sonia Sotomayor; and Howard Dean's town hall meeting with Jim Moran of Virginia's 8th District.

Mr. Beacham states:

"I am like the boy who said the Emperor is naked. There is still abortion funding in H.R. 3200, we are not fooled by Obama's empty rhetoric. He lies with a smile and the common folk are either believing him, or ignoring his lies to protect their own selfishness."

Outside, the rest of the organization did street theater and skits. They have been demonstrating and preaching every morning in front of various congressional offices. Later, Operation Rescue Insurrecta Nex members held signs of the victims of abortion outside Sidwell Friends High School.
